About Milton

A town in Southern Ontario and part of Halton Region in the Greater Toronto Area. Milton received significant attention as Canada's fastest growing municipality with a 71.4% increase in population between 2001 and 2006, and 56.4% between 2006 and 2011.

Attractions

Located 40 km west of Downtown Toronto on Highway 401, Milton serves as the western terminus for the Milton GO Transit line. The town sits on the edge of the Niagara Escarpment, a UNESCO world biosphere reserve.

Nature & Parks

Rattlesnake Point, Crawford Lake Conservation Area, and Kelso Conservation Area offer spectacular escarpment hiking, rock climbing, and natural beauty. The Bruce Trail traverses the community.

Lifestyle

Excellent GTA access via Highways 401 and 407, GO Transit connections, and proximity to Toronto Pearson Airport. New subdivisions, schools, and commercial centres support the growing population.
